Output d70d7f621bce60e8fc8f2765e69b2a658c0ef521b2e7e42608bad5dda37674ec:0

value
623435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ed0eb86a5a00f73c6f91b5169a18ea97024179 OP_EQUAL
address
3Pvn7ChUa4F8j3WSivxALXNa3ijea3F7La
transaction
d70d7f621bce60e8fc8f2765e69b2a658c0ef521b2e7e42608bad5dda37674ec
spent
true